How to Employ a Roofing Cost Calculator

Using a roof cost calculator is a clear-cut process that can greatly aid in understanding the financial requirements of your roofing project. To initiate, collect essential information about your roof. This includes the size of your roof, the kind of roofing material you are considering, and any particular features like chimneys or skylights that might impact the installation. Precise measurements ensure that the estimates generated by the calculator will be dependable and relevant to your project.

Once you have the necessary information, head to a trustworthy roof cost calculator on the internet. Input your data carefully, taking the time to select options that suit your situation, such as the roof material type and the complexity of the roof design. Many calculators also let you to factor in additional variables such as labor costs or geographic location, which can affect the total expense. This step is crucial for obtaining a comprehensive estimate that considers all variables in your roofing project.

After submitting your information, examine the generated estimate. This will provide you with a detailed view of costs, permitting you to see how different factors affect to the overall price. Take this time to play around with different materials or configurations to see how changes impact the budget. Employing the calculator not only helps in budgeting but also aids in choosing appropriately about the best roofing solutions for your home or commercial building.

Elements That Influence Roofing Cost Estimates

Multiple key elements determine the roof pricing calculations produced by a roofing pricing calculator. A major factor refers to to the dimensions of a roof. Bigger roofs require additional materials and labor, significantly influencing overall costs. One must important to accurately measure the roof's dimensions accurately to achieve a reliable estimate, as just differences can lead to considerable changes regarding pricing.

A further crucial factor refers to the type of roofing materials picked for the project. Different materials feature diverse price points, lifespan, and upkeep requirements. For example, asphalt shingles tend to be less cost-effective upfront compared to metal or tile options, that may be costlier but expensive but provide greater durability. Comprehending the characteristics and costs associated with each material are vital when using a roof cost calculator to make sure the budget coincides with a homeowner's goals.

Lastly, workforce costs and location likewise play a significant role in determining roof estimates. Labor prices can fluctuate significantly depending on regional area, the roofing job, and the experience level of the contractors. Factoring in these variables into your calculations can help homeowners obtain a more budget. Understanding these factors will result in a comprehensive understanding of what to expect in terms of the cost estimate and help making wise decisions.
